Recently, researchers from Ningbo Materials Institute of the Chinese Academy of Sciences have developed an ultra-black and high-stability light absorption coating technology, which can be used to suppress the interference of stray light in optics and improve the efficiency of solar photothermal conversion.
The coating uses physical vapor deposition technology, can be coated on the surface of most commonly used materials such as metals, ceramics, polymers, and even on the surface of flexible polymer film, the coating binding force is high, the physical and chemical properties of the coating is stable, high hardness.
One of the researchers of this coating technology, Abdul Ghafar Wattoo, a Pakistani doctoral student studying at the University of the Chinese Academy of Sciences, said the results were part of a study he participated in during his ph.D. studies in the Surface Protection Group of the Ningbo Institute of Materials of the Chinese Academy of Sciences, coated with TiAlN ternate ceramics, with light absorption covering near-infrared, visible and ultraviolet bands with a light absorption rate of more than 95%

The coating has a delicate nanostructure, the bottom layer structure, is conducive to improving its adhesion on a variety of substation materials, the middle is a column structure, the column interface of multiple reflections to absorb the energy of light, the top is a conical structure, conducive to the introduction of incoming light, but the preparation method is very simple.
This light absorption coating has a light absorption coefficient of more than 95% in the wavelength range of 200nm to 2500nm, covering near-infrared, visible and ultraviolet, with the widest wavelength absorption rate in existing ceramic light absorption coatings. Due to the low cost of coating preparation and stable physical and chemical properties, it can be widely used in optical instrument stray light control, energy conversion and other fields in the future. The results of this work were published in Journal of Materials Chemistry C, 2018, 6, 8646-8662, Solar Energy, 2016, 138, 1-9. The technology has been declared invention patent 2 CN201210063873.8, DD180138I.
